Power Dynamos Football Club (PDFC) secured a convincing five-nil victory at home against Forest Rangers Football Club, propelling them to third place on the league table.
The Osward Mutapa-tutored side only took five minutes to open the scoreline with an excellent Austin Muwowo finish. Captain Godfrey Ngwenya Godfrey provided the superb assist for the goal.
The visitors, led by former Power Dynamos Coach Mwenya Chipepo, pushed for a leveller in the 18th minute when former Power winger Tiki Chiluba had an unmarked chance to head the ball into the net, but unfortunately, he was unable to convert.
Instead, the home side took control of the game and secured a second goal, thanks to an impressive run by Fredrick Mulambia.
At halftime, Power Dynamos were in the lead with two goals.
Power appeared increasingly threatening in the second half, building on the momentum from the first half.
In the 57th minute, Austin Muwowo skillfully scored with a left-footed shot outside the boot, securing his second goal and giving Power Dynamos a three-goal lead.
With three goals already on the scoreboard, Coach Osward Mutapa was hungry for more. He made a strategic substitution, bringing in striker Moses Phiri for midfielder Fredrick Mulambia, who scored his goal from a brilliantly executed team effort in six minutes, bringing Power’s total to four.
In the 88th minute, there was a double substitution as Beby Onka Musangala and young Moses Mulenga came on for Godfrey Ngwenya and Austin Muwowo.
As if the score line had not told the story enough, Joshua Mutale’s relentless run, following a semblance of the typical passing game that power Dynamos is known for, ended up with the ball in the back of the net for goal number five after he rounded the charging Kakunta in the 94th minute.
Power are now third on the log, with 51 points, four behind Zesco United and two ahead of fourth-placed Maestro United Zambia Football Club (Muza FC).
On Saturday, May 18, 2024, Power will travel to Solwezi district in the north-western part of Zambia for a week-long 32-man fixture against Trident Football Club.
